Sony has officially kicked off its marketing campaign for Grand Theft Auto VI (GTA 6) following the launch of pre-orders on PlayStation 5 and Xbox Series X/S. The company is positioning the highly anticipated title as a premium experience on its console, claiming that GTA 6 will “play best on PS5” thanks to a close collaboration with Rockstar Games.
The marketing push highlights several PlayStation-exclusive enhancements that aim to deliver a more immersive gameplay experience when GTA 6 launches.

Sony Highlights PS5-Specific GTA 6 Features
In a recent PlayStation Blog post, Sony detailed how Rockstar Games has optimized GTA 6 for the PlayStation 5 ecosystem. The company says players can expect full support for the PS5’s advanced hardware and software features.
One of the biggest highlights is support for the DualSense wireless controller, allowing players to experience enhanced immersion through:
- Adaptive Triggers
- Haptic Feedback
- Integrated Controller Speaker
According to Sony, these features will add greater realism to gameplay, making vehicle handling, combat encounters, and in-game interactions feel more dynamic.
Enhanced Audio and Faster Loading Times
GTA 6 will also take advantage of Tempest 3D Audio Technology, enabling more realistic environmental sounds and spatial audio effects throughout the game’s massive open world.
Additionally, Rockstar is utilizing the PS5’s high-speed SSD storage to deliver significantly reduced loading times. Sony claims players can expect near-instant transitions into gameplay, helping maintain immersion while exploring the game’s expansive environments.
PlayStation Store and PS5 UI Get GTA 6 Makeover
As part of its promotional campaign, Sony has already started integrating GTA 6 branding across its ecosystem.
The PlayStation App icon has adopted visual elements inspired by GTA 6’s signature artwork, while the PS5 home screen now features a special animation showcasing the iconic “VI” logo before displaying game-related content.
The PlayStation Store homepage has also been redesigned to prominently feature GTA 6, including dedicated sections for:
- Pre-order bonuses
- Ultimate Edition content
- Special rewards and digital extras
- Game information and updates
These changes demonstrate Sony’s significant marketing investment ahead of the game’s release.

GTA 6 Pre-Order Price in India
Grand Theft Auto VI is now available for pre-order through PlayStation and Xbox digital storefronts.
India Pricing
- GTA 6 Standard Edition: Rs. 5,999
- GTA 6 Ultimate Edition: Rs. 7,499
The Ultimate Edition includes additional in-game content such as exclusive outfits, vehicles, weapons, and other bonuses.
